又为什么要换成kotlin
为了跨平台,之前安卓是一个小公司开发的被谷歌收购了
Java天然可以跨平台,跨得又方便,而且库多。Kotlin是因为接入JVM没啥成本,而且能简化Java。
因为早期Java是当时解决跨平台一致性的成熟语言。 而淘汰java转向kotlin纯粹是google的力推。有着更简化的语法和更现代的特性支持。函数式编程、原生协程支持、类型推断和自转换。
从 软件开发 到 快问快答
From #develop:qa to 开发调优